I wanted to add some more "impressions".

Madden is really surprising me at times. I have DJ Williams and Al Wilson on my team. They are monsters as they are both 85+. I don't know their exact stats. Anyway, whether you like it or not, they seem to be able to evade blockers and get in on a play. Rating do my a heck of a difference as Sykes just is your average LB that often times gets stuck in a block. The good news is Al Wilson is so quick and his awareness is high enough that he usually helps the lower rated LBs.

Blocking is really nice. Its not the best as sometimes I think the AI just says here ya go have at the QB. But its usually on lower rated linemen. There is actually a push this year allowing better DL get past OL but get "pushed" upfield. And don't forget blockers. If you have a FB with a low Run Block rating you can forget it as he's not going to be that big of a help.

The reason I'm writing this in a sliders thread is that these Sliders on ALL-PRO really create an even handed game (though the AI on AP isn't 100% great). You will get 13-6 games. Then a 35-28 affair the next game. I've had games were I go 13-30 for 100 yards then 25-25 for 250+. My completion rating is a bit low because I always try to go for the first and sometimes fail to hit my safety outlets.

Running is still a little bit low for the CPU. I don't know if its because of my LBs as I mention before or the AI on all-pro doesn't like to run. I do wish they they put people in motion more often and called audibles. But its not a game killer.

Just thought I would post an update. I'm going to Madden a couple days rest because I'm been playing non-stop for the last week. But its really a solid game. Through in the neat franchise options and you have one of the most complete football games made. Again not perfect but complete.

I have figured this out:

No matter what sliders you use (realistic ones, not over compensating for the CPU lack of a run game ones), if you react to the run with your human controlled player faster than the computer would react with him if you weren't controlling him, you will always stop the run easily.

Think about it. If you control a safety in this game, and are in Cover 2, but attack the run, that isn't realistic. Eventually, you will be burned by play action, but in the real NFL, unless you are being beat by the run consistently, safties stay back.

I'll make it easy, booker. Play a few games where you don't control anyone on defense. Just take your hands off the joystick. See how you do at rish defense.

Personally, I play as a FS or SS with the Ravens, and I stay back as the last line of defense. I will come up once in a while, but my first move on every play is the designed move in the play (more times than not I step backwards due to being in a cover 2/3 scheme). If a runner gets by my first two levels of defense, then I go for the tackle.

That is how I get a realistic game with these sliders.
